My cat chewed on and possibly swallowed part of a Nerf dart, is this dangerous?

Earlier today, I found my cat playing with a Nerf dart and it looks like she might have chewed off and swallowed a piece of it. I'm really worried because I'm not sure if this could harm her digestive system in any way. Is swallowing a bit of Nerf dart dangerous for cats, and should I take her to the vet for an examination?

Answer

It's understandable to be worried when your cat swallows something unexpected like a piece of a Nerf dart. While small objects can sometimes pass through a cat's digestive system without any issues, there is a potential risk of obstruction or other complications.

  • Monitor your cat for signs of digestive distress.
  • Small, soft items might pass, but be cautious of any unusual symptoms.
  • Consult a vet if you notice vomiting, lack of appetite, or lethargy.

Swallowing non-food items is always a concern, especially with cats, as their digestive systems are not designed to process such materials. While something as small as a piece of foam or plastic might pass on its own, it's crucial to watch for signs that it might be causing an obstruction, such as vomiting, not eating, or acting lethargic. If you notice any of these symptoms, or if your cat seems to be in pain or discomfort, it is best to consult with a vet as soon as possible to ensure there aren't any complications.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What signs should I watch for if my cat swallows something unusual?

    Look for symptoms such as vomiting, decreased appetite, lethargy, or signs of abdominal pain. These could indicate that the item is causing a blockage or other issue.

  • Can a small piece of plastic or foam pass through my cat without causing harm?

    In some cases, small items may pass through the digestive tract without incident. However, it's important to monitor your cat and consult a vet if any symptoms appear.

  • How urgently should I react if I suspect my cat has ingested something harmful?

    If your cat shows any signs of distress or you suspect they have ingested something potentially dangerous, it's crucial to seek veterinary advice immediately to prevent possible complications.
